1.Study on the effect and mechanism of modified Yanghe decoction on bone destruction in rats with breast cancer bone metastasis
Shun LU ; Ang CAI ; Tingting FAN ; Weihua HE
China Pharmacy 2026;37(4):431-437
OBJECTIVE To explore the improvement effect and potential mechanism of modified Yanghe decoction on bone destruction in rats with breast cancer bone metastasis based on the receptor-interacting serine/threonine-protein kinase 1 (RIPK1)/RIPK3 pathway. METHODS The rat model of breast cancer bone metastasis was established by injecting a suspension of breast cancer cells into the bone marrow cavity. The rats with successful modeling were randomly divided into a model group (intragastric administration of equal volume of normal saline), modified Yanghe decoction low-, medium-, and high-dose groups (intragastric administration of corresponding decoction at 1.30, 2.60 and 5.20 g/kg, calculated by the dosage of crude drug), high-dose modified Yanghe decoction+si-RIPK1 group (intragastric administration of corresponding decoction at 5.20 g/kg, calculated by the dosage of crude drug; simultaneous injection of small interfering RNA for RIPK1 via the tail vein), and high-dose modified Yanghe decoction+si-NC group (intragastric administration of corresponding decoction at 5.20 g/kg, calculated by the dosage of crude drug; simultaneous injection of small interfering RNA for negative control via the tail vein), with 12 rats in each group. Another 12 healthy rats were selected as the control group and were given the same volume of normal saline intragastrically, once a day, for 14 consecutive days. Body weight was measured before administration and at the end of the last administration. The mechanical pain threshold and thermal pain threshold were measured, and the bone destruction, pathological changes and osteoclast formation of the tibia were observed. The positive expression of receptor activator of nuclear factor-κB (RANK) and receptor activator of nuclear factor-κB ligand (RANKL) in the tibial tissue, as well as the phosphorylation levels of RIPK1, RIPK3 and mixed lineage kinase domain-like protein (MLKL) were detected. RESULTS Compared with the control group, the tumor cells of tibia tissues in rats of the model group showed significant proliferation and diffuse infiltration into the bone marrow cavity. Extensive areas of tumor necrosis of cells, severe bone destruction, thinning of the bone cortex, and damage to the bone trabeculae were observed. The body weight (before administration and at the end of the last administration), mechanical pain threshold, thermal pain threshold, and the phosphorylation levels of RIPK1, RIPK3 and MLKL were decreased significantly; the tumor volume, the proportion of bone destruction area, the number of osteoclasts, and the positive expressions of RANK and RANKL were increased/up-regulated significantly (P<0.05). Compared with the model group, the above pathological changes in the tibial tissues of rats in modified Yanghe decoction low-, medium- and high-dose groups were all alleviated, and all quantitative indicators showed dose-dependent improvement (P<0.05). After silencing RIPK1, the aforementioned beneficial effects of high-dose modified Yanghe decoction were significantly weakened (P<0.05).CONCLUSIONSModified Yanghe decoction can alleviate bone destruction in rats with breast cancer bone metastasis. The above effect is related to the activation of the RIPK1/RIPK3 pathway.

3.Effect of uric acid level and sugar sweetened beverage intake on elevated blood pressure among children and adolescents in Guangzhou
ZHANG Zehui, JI Jiting, LONG Jiayi, PAN Shun, MO Miaoling, LU Zhiqing, LI Boyuan, CHEN Jiayu, LIU Li
Chinese Journal of School Health 2026;47(6):878-882
Objective:
To investigate the association between uric acid level and elevated blood pressure among children and adolescents in Guangzhou, so as to provide a scientific basis for prevention and control of hypertension in the pediatric population.
Methods:
From March to December 2019, using stratified cluster random sampling, 3 626 children and adolescents aged 6-17 years without elevated blood pressure at baseline were recruited from 6 primary and secondary schools in Guangzhou. Serum uric acid levels were measured at baseline, and divided into four groups ( Q1-Q 4) based on age and sex specific quartiles for analyses. Two waves of follow up were carried out from October 2020 to May 2021 and from October 2021 to May 2022, respectively. Multilevel robust Poisson regression was used to evaluate the association between uric acid level and elevated blood pressure among children and adolescents. The additive interaction between high uric acid level and sugar sweetened beverage (SSB) intake on elevated blood pressure was assessed by stratification analysis and calculation of the relative excess risk due to interaction (RERI).
Results:
A total of 1 131 new cases of elevated blood pressure were identified during the two follow ups, with an incidence density of 130.5 cases 1 000 person years. Multilevel robust Poisson regression analysis showed that after adjusting for confounders such as gender, age and annual family income, compared with those in the uric acid Q 1 level, the risk of elevated blood pressure in individuals in the Q 4 level increased by 25% ( RR=1.25, 95%CI =1.08-1.44), and the risk of elevated systolic blood pressure increased by 20% ( RR=1.20, 95%CI =1.05-1.36) (both P <0.05); no statistical association was observed between uric acid and elevated diastolic blood pressure (all P >0.05). In the stratified analysis, the statistical associations of uric acid Q 4 level with elevated blood pressure ( RR=1.34, 95%CI =1.13-1.58) and elevated systolic blood pressure ( RR=1.33, 95%CI =1.14-1.55) were only observed in the group with SSB intake ≥ 250 mL/week (both P <0.05). The RERI values for the effect of uric acid Q 4 and Q 3 levels with SSB intake ≥ 250 mL/week on elevated systolic and diastolic blood pressure were 0.29 and 0.44 (both P <0.05).
Conclusions
High uric acid level is a risk factor for elevated blood pressure among children and adolescents, with a predominant effect on systolic blood pressure. High uric acid level and SSB intake synergistically promote the increase of blood pressure of children and adolescents.
4.A preliminary study on a method for detecting accelerator isocenter deviation using an optical surface monitoring system
Jianqi HU ; Shun ZHOU ; Jiangyan LUO ; Zihong LU ; Junyu LI ; Wen WANG ; Hao WU
Chinese Journal of Radiological Health 2026;35(2):263-271
Objective To detect the isocenter of a medical linear accelerator using an optical surface monitoring system (OSMS) combined with a self-made 3D-printed phantom, and compare with the conventional front pointer measurement method. Methods A phantom that could be fixed to the front pointer of the accelerator was fabricated using 3D printing technology. The front pointer method and OSMS were used to detect the rotation isocenter deviations of the accelerator. During the experiments, the collimator, gantry, and couch linear displacement readings were recorded at different angles. We also recorded the measurement time of different surveyors. Results Compared to the front pointer measurement method, the OSMS method showed lower standard deviations. The reductions in standard deviations showed statistical significance in the Lat direction for the collimator rotation isocenter as well as in the Lat and Vrt directions for the gantry rotation isocenter. The mean deviation of Mag values for the collimator rotation isocenter using the OSMS method was 0.50 mm, which was larger than the 0.42 mm using the front pointer method. However, the standard deviation was 0.06 using the OSMS method, which was smaller than the 0.18 using the front pointer method. The mean deviation and standard deviation of Sag values for the gantry rotation isocenter using the OSMS method were 1.03 mm and 0.12, respectively, which were both larger than 0.47 mm and 0.06 using the front pointer method. For the couch rotation isocenter, the mean deviation and standard deviation using the OSMS method were 0.32 mm and 0.04, respectively, which were both smaller than the 0.55 mm and 0.20 using the front pointer method. All surveyors spent less time in isocenter measurements using the OSMS method compared to the front pointer method. Conclusion Compared with the front pointer method, the OSMS method significantly reduces the standard deviation among surveyors, effectively reduces the influence of the angle deviation of the accelerator on the measurement results, reduces detection time, improves detection efficiency, and provides a powerful practical basis for the application of OSMS in detecting the mechanical accuracy of the linear accelerator.

7.A Retrospective Clinical Analysis of Multiple Myeloma Patients with Cardiac Amyloidosis.
Tian-Yue BIAN ; Shun WANG ; Qun LU ; Shi-Hui YUAN ; Rui LI ; Rui XU ; Ying CHEN ; Hua-Sheng LIU
Journal of Experimental Hematology 2025;33(3):834-840
OBJECTIVE:
To investigate the clinical characteristics, curative effect and prognostic factors of patients with multiple myeloma (MM) complicated with light chain myocardial amyloidosis (AL-CA).
METHODS:
The data of 38 patients diagnosed with MM complicated with AL-CA in our hospital from January 2018 to December 2023 were retrospectively analyzed, and the data were comprehensively screened by multiple methods such as positive two-dimensional spot tracking echocardiography (2D-STE). Survival analysis was performed using the Kaplan-Meier method. Cox regression models were used to screen for independent prognostic factors.
RESULTS:
Among the 38 MM patients with AL-CA, 23 were male and 15 were female, with a median age of 60(50,75) years. The 1-year survival rate was 71.05%. Patients who underwent transplantation had significantly better survival outcomes than those who did not (P < 0.01). Additionally, the median survival time of patients with all-negative FISH results at the first visit was statistically different compared to patients with other mutations (P < 0.05). Multivariate Cox regression analysis showed that all negative FISH results at the first visit and the absence of autologous hematopoietic stem cell transplantation (ASCT) were not independent risk factor for the prognosis of patients with MM and AL-CA (P >0.05).
CONCLUSION
ASCT may improve the prognosis of MM patients with AL-CA, and negative FISH results may indicate poor prognosis, but the results still need to be verified by larger samples.

8.Hypofractionated radiotherapy combined with transcatheter arterial chemoembolization for the treatment of metachronous hepatic oligometastasis from nasopharyngeal carcinoma:analysis of its clinical effect
Yecai HUANG ; Jie ZHOU ; Peng ZHANG ; Shun LU ; Jingyi LANG ; Guohui XU ; Xuegang YANG
Journal of Interventional Radiology 2025;34(9):992-996
Objective To explore the effectiveness and safety of hypofractionated radiotherapy(HFRT)combined with transcatheter arterial chemoembolization(TACE)for metachronous hepatic oligometastasis from nasopharyngeal carcinoma(NPC).Methods The clinical data of patients with metachronous hepatic oligometastasis from NPC,who received HFRT combined with TACE treatment at the Sichuan Provincial Cancer Hospital of China from January 2012 to October 2022,were retrospectively analyzed.The 3-year and 5-year overall survival(OS),progression-free survival(PFS),local recurrence-free survival(LRFS),no extrahepatic distant metastasis survival(EMFS),and treatment-related adverse reactions were analyzed.Results A total of 55 patients were enrolled in this study,including 36 males and 19 females,the median age at the time of occurring metachronous hepatic oligometastasis was 44(27-75)years.The 3-year and 5-year OS,PFS,LRFS,EMFS were 67.8%and 40.0%,55.8%and 30.0%,72.7%and 56.5%,63.6%and 56.5%,respectively.The subgroup analysis indicated that the treatment course of TACE ≥3 cycles could significantly improve the PFS of patients with oligometastasis.HFRT combined with TACE treatment was well tolerated by all patients,and the incidence of Grade Ⅲ-Ⅳadverse reactions was quite low.Conclusion For the treatment of metachronous hepatic oligometastasis from NPC,HFRT combined with TACE is clinically effective,besides,the patients can well tolerate the therapeutic scheme.
9.The clinical characteristics and microbial distribution of sepsis-induced myocardial injury
Sun YU ; Chunyang XU ; Hongwei YE ; Shun WEN ; Liang YANG ; Caiyun YANG ; Shiqi LU ; Meili SHEN
Chinese Journal of Emergency Medicine 2025;34(2):173-179
Objective:To investigate the clinical characteristics of sepsis-induced myocardial injury and microbial distribution.Methods:It was a retrospective observational study conducted from Jan 2023 to Dec 2023 in the Department of Emergency Intensive Care Medicine, Changshu Hospital Affiliated to Soochow University. Patients meeting the sepsis 3.0 criteria were included, excluding those with underlying cardiovascular diseases or incomplete data. Patients were categorized into myocardial injury (SIMI) and non-myocardial injury (Non-SIMI) groups based on troponin levels. General patient information, laboratory results, microbial findings, and prognostic indicators were collected. Differences in clinical parameters between the two groups were compared. Factors showing statistical differences in univariate analysis were further analyzed using multivariable logistic regression to identify risk factors for SIMI. Conduct propensity score matching among Pulmonary infection patients who underwent bronchoalveolar lavage high-throughput sequencing to compare microbial distribution between groups. Bracken was used to estimate species-level abundance from Kraken2 results, and α and β diversity analyses were conducted on the metagenomic samples.Results:A total of 179 patients were included in the study, with 98 (54.4%) in the Non-SIMI group and 81 (45.5%) in the SIMI group. There were 69 deaths overall (38.5%), with 23 (23.7%) in the Non-SIMI group and 46 (56.8%) in the SIMI group (χ 2=20.347, P<0.01). The 28-day survival curve indicated survival rates in the SIMI group were significantly lower compared to the Non-SIMI group (Log Rank χ 2=21.270, P<0.01). Univariate analysis revealed that fungal infection rate ( P=0.007), C-reactive protein ( P=0.021), procalcitonin, blood urea nitrogen, creatinine, alanine transaminase, and lactate levels were higher in the SIMI group compared to the Non-SIMI group (all P<0.01), prothrombin time was prolonger ( P<0.01) and APACHEⅡ scores were higher ( P<0.01), while serum albumin, base excess, and platelet levels were lower (all P<0.01). Multivariable logistic regression analysis indicated that fungal infection ( OR=3.441, P=0.015) was a risk factor for SIMI, whereas base excess and platelets were protective factors ( OR=0.845, 0.988, both P<0.01). Comparison of bronchoalveolar lavage high-throughput sequencing results in the pulmonary infection subgroup showed the relative abundance of Haemophilus paraininfluenzae in Non-SIMI group was higher than SIMI group among the top 20 species ( P=0.013). There were no statistically significant differences in microbial αand β-diversity between the two groups. Conclusions:The incidence of SIMI is relatively highamong sepsis patients and it affects their prognosis. Risk factors for SIMI include fungal infection, decreased platelet count, and reduced base excess levels. Among patients with pulmonary infections, there is a lower risk of SIMI associated with Haemophilus influenzae infection.
10.Development and clinical application of amputation scale for severe open pelvic fractures
Weicheng XU ; Fanxiao LIU ; Shun LU ; Jinlei DONG ; Dongsheng ZHOU ; Lianxin LI
Chinese Journal of Orthopaedics 2025;45(8):463-468
Objective:To develop the Amputation Scale for Severe Open Pelvic Fractures and explore its application value in patients with severe open pelvic fractures.Methods:A total of 27 patients with severe open pelvic fractures who underwent surgical treatment in Shandong Provincial Hospital Affiliated to Shandong First Medical University from January 2010 to January 2023 were retrospectively analyzed. There were 15 males and 12 females, aged 38.6±11.6 years (range, 13-65 years). There were 13 cases of traffic injuries, 10 cases of fall from height injuries, and 4 cases of mechanical crushing injuries; 20 cases were admitted to the hospital in emergency, and 7 cases were transferred from other hospitals. All fracture types were Tile C, including 14 cases of Tile C1, 8 cases of Tile C2, and 5 cases of Tile C3. There were 16 cases of genitourinary system injury, 8 cases of anal or rectal injury, 12 cases of abdominal injury, 9 cases of chest injury, and 6 cases of craniocerebral trauma. The mangled extremity severity score (MESS) and the Amputation Scale for Severe Open Pelvic Fractures were used to evaluate whether amputation was performed. The sensitivity, specificity, positive predictive value, negative predictive value and accuracy of the two evaluation methods were calculated.Results:Among the 27 patients, 21 cases were treated with pelvic external fixator to control the volume, 16 cases were treated with gauze packing to stop bleeding, 8 cases were treated with temporary abdominal aorta occlusion, and 12 cases were treated with laparotomy because of abdominal injury. Seven of the 27 patients died, with a mortality rate of 26%. In 12 cases of one-stage amputation, 3 cases died, including 1 case died of multiple organ failure syndrome, 1 case died of gastrointestinal bleeding on the 7th day after amputation, and 1 case died of severe infection on the 4th day after amputation. Among the 15 cases of one-stage limb salvage, 4 cases died, of which 2 cases of second-stage amputation died of infection on the 5th day after one-stage limb salvage, and 1 case of one-stage limb salvage died of limb necrosis on the 3rd day after one-stage limb salvage. Two patients died of multiple organ failure syndrome. The MESS score of 27 patients was 6(6, 8) points (range, 6-13 points), and the Amputation Scale for Severe Open Pelvic Fractures score was 9.6±1.8 points (range, 6-14 points). The sensitivity, specificity, positive predictive value, negative predictive value and accuracy of MESS were 66.7%, 50%, 40%, 75% and 56%, respectively, while those of Amputation Scale for Severe Open Pelvic Fractures were 80%, 89%, 73%, 88% and 82%, respectively. The specificity and accuracy of MESS were significantly lower than those of Amputation Scale for Severe Open Pelvic Fractures ( P<0.05). All 20 patients who survived were followed up for 23.6±7.5 months (range, 11-37 months). Five cases had soft tissue infection at the stump of amputation, which were treated with debridement, and 3 cases underwent skin grafting, and the stump healed well at the last follow-up. Conclusion:The Amputation Scale for Severe Open Pelvic Fractures is better than MESS in the assessment of early amputation in patients with severe pelvic fractures.
